Explorative Datenanalyse (EDA) ist eine Technik zur Analyse von Datensätzen, um ihre Hauptmerkmale zusammenzufassen, oft unter Verwendung visueller Methoden.

Explorative Datenanalyse (EDA)

Explorativ Datenanalyse (EDA) is a crucial step in the Datenanalyseprozess, focusing on the initial investigation of Datensätze zu identifizieren. to discover patterns, spot anomalies, test hypotheses, and check assumptions. EDA employs a variety of techniques, primarily graphical and quantitative methods, to provide insights into the structure and relationships within the data.

The main goal of EDA is to understand the underlying structure of the data, which can inform further statistische Modellierung und Entscheidungsfindung. Die in der EDA verwendeten Techniken umfassen:

  • Deskriptive Statistik: Summarizing data using measures such as mean, median, mode, range, and standard deviation.
  • Datenvisualisierung: Creating visual representations of data, such as histograms, scatter plots, box plots, and heatmaps, to identify trends and correlations.
  • Datenbereinigung: Identifying and handling missing values, outliers, and inconsistencies to prepare the data for analysis.

EDA is iterative and often leads to new questions or hypotheses about the data, guiding the analysis process. By conducting EDA, analysts can gain a deeper understanding of the data, which can help in selecting the appropriate statistische Techniken und Modelle für weitere Analysen.

Zusammenfassend ist die Explorative Datenanalyse eine wesentliche Praxis in Datenwissenschaft and statistics that emphasizes the importance of understanding data before applying more complex methods.
